U.S. Manufacturing Exported to 234 Countries in 2013


In 2013, the United States exported manufactured products to 234 countries, with most going to just a few areas; exports to the top 10 countries and regions made up 72% of the total.

Canada and Mexico are natural markets for our products considering their proximity and they are the top two destinations for U.S. manufacturers. NAFTA allows U.S. manufacturers to take advantage of the nations’ beneficial industry and cost structures and optimize their supply chains by exporting components and intermediate products to affiliate manufacturing companies for further processing.

The Eurozone received 13% of U.S. manufacturing’s exports in 2013, making it the third largest export destination. China continues to be a common export destination.
